Blackberry launches Blackberry DTEK50 and DTEK60 in India

Blackberry DTEK60

Blackberry has finally launched its new Android powered smartphones Blackberry DTEK50 and Blackberry DTEK60 in Indian market today that comes with the price tag of Rs. 21,990 (around $330) and Rs. 46,990 (around $704) respectively. The Blackberry DTEK50 was announced in July this year, while the Blackberry DTEK60 was launched last month in some of the European countries. Both comes with Black color option and as for the availability the BlackBerry DTEK50 will be available from November 13th, while the DTEK60 will be available from December in the country.

BlackBerry DTEK50
BlackBerry DTEK50

The Blackberry DTEK50 comes with a 5.2-inch full HD scratch-resistant display with 1920 x 1080 pixels resolution and is powered by the octa-core Snapdragon 617 (4 x 1.5GHz + 4 x 1.2GHz) processor with 550MHz Adreno 405 GPU. It has 3GB of RAM and 16GB of inbuilt storage capacity with microSD card expandable storage slot up to 2TB. It runs on the Android 6.0 (Marshmallow) and will be available in single SIM option.

It features a 13-megapixel auto-focus rear camera with Phase Detection Auto Focus (PDAF), Fast focus lock, HDR, 6-element f2.0 lens, Dual tone dual LED Flash and other features. It also has a 8-megapixel fixed-focus front facing camera with f2.2 aperture, 1.125um pixel size, 84 degrees wide angle view lens and Image & video stabilisation.

It has a 2610mAh battery with fast charging enabled and connectivity options includes 4G LTE, 3G, 2G,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n 2.4 GHz with 4G Mobile Hotspot  and Wi-Fi Direct, FM Radio, Bluetooth 4.2 LE and EDR, GPS with Assisted, Autonomous and Simultaneous GPS, GLONASS, BeiDou, OTDOA, NFC and a 3.5mm audio jack. It measures 147×72.5×7.4mm and weights 135g.

Blackberry DTEK60
Blackberry DTEK60

The Blackberry DTEK60 comes with a 5.5-inch diagonal Quad-HD AMOLED display with 2560 x 1440 pixel resolution, 24-bit color depth, 534 PPI and 16:9 aspect ratio. It is powered by a 64-bit quad-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 820 (MSM8996 with 64 bit Quad-Core 2+2 Kryo 2.15GHz / 1.6GHz) processor with a 624MHz Adreno 530 GPU. it has 4GB of RAM and 32 GB inbuilt storage capacity with microSD expandable storage card supporting up to 2TB storage. It runs on the Android 6.0 Marshmallow OS out of the box.

It features a 21-megapixel auto-focus rear camera with Dual Tone LED Flash, 4K HD Video Recording at 30 fps, Phase Detect Auto Focus (PDAF), Fast focus lock, HDR, 6-element f2.0 lens, 4x digital zoom, Continuous & touch to focus, face detection, video image stabilization and Multi-frame Low Light Enhancement features. A front facing 8-megapixel camera is also available with Selfie Flash, fixed-focus, f2.2 aperture, 1.125um pixel size, 84° wide angle/field of view lens, HDR, Live Filters, video image stabilization and Multi-Frame Low Light Enhancement.

It has a 3000 mAh 4.4V non-removable battery with Quick Charge 3.0 enabled delivering up to 24 hours of mixed usage. Connectivity options includes 4G LT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n 2.4 GHz, 4G Mobile Hotspot, Wi-Fi Direct, Bluetooth 4.2 (LE) and EDR, GPS, GLONASS, BeiDou, NFC, USB Type-C with standard USB Type C to USB Type A cable and USB OTG and a 3.5 mm headphone jack. It measures 153.9 mm x 75.4 mm x 6.99 mm and weights 165 grams. The device also comes with an on-screen or red LED indicator and also has a fingerprint scanner on the rear side.
